Career Path
Leadership Coaching: High demand for professionals who can guide senior executives and managers in achieving organisational goals.
Career Development Coaching: Increasing need for coaches who support employees in career progression and skill enhancement.
Team Coaching: Growing focus on improving team dynamics and collaboration within organisations.
Executive Coaching: Specialised coaching for C-suite leaders to enhance decision-making and strategic thinking.
Wellness Coaching: Emerging demand for coaches who promote mental health and work-life balance in the workplace.
